English Although the current Covid situation does not allow events with a live audience, the filmmakers decided to hold the traditional Czech Lions ceremony. Everything seemed unfinished. All the performers did not know what to do. The nominees stood in their places and after the announcement were made, they kept around looking where and when they should go. During the interviews, they didn't know when to start talking and what to do after the interview was over. Not to mention the disabled microphone in the end of the evening... Václav Kopta was not funny even once during the whole evening and it all culminated in a moment when he interviewed himself. Towards the end, he started playing the piano to his colleague's monologue and listening to what the presenter was saying was a struggle. The lights in the photo booth beeped behind this presenter throughout the interviews and by half time it was really getting on my nerves. On a positive note, the set decoration and lighting was much better after last year and made it look cosy. The whole evening was a huge disappointment and I can absolutely understand if someone didn't watch the show till the end.

Like Summer Snow (2021) 

English A very enjoyable and well-made docudrama about Comenius. No boredom, straight downhill ride. I don't think direct historical context is needed as the film is full of new information and simple details that work well as a one whole thing. I do regret, however, that there is almost no archaism in the dialogue. If more archaic language had been heard, it would have added another dimension to the film and actually made it feel even more authentic. Still, the film is a good one and it is definitely one of the films that will be talked about for a long time - and not only in the context of Czech history.

Vitamania: The Sense and Nonsense of Vitamins (2018) 

English Interesting documentary full of information about vitamins. Unfortunately, more than half of the film consists of personal stories of different people about how large or small amounts of vitamins have affected their health. Each story could have been told in five sentences, not 10 minutes, which wasted time during which new and more important information could have been conveyed to the audience. The other sticking point is that only a quarter of the vitamins are discussed in detail in the film - not a bad thing, but a shame. The narrative of how vitamins evolved was interesting and the film explored the history of vitamins in depth. On a positive note, the musical interludes sweetened the film nicely. In the end, the film has an excellent theme, but the actual craft is a bit worse.

The Sound Is Innocent (2019) 

English This richly narrative film impresses not only with its visuals but also with its excellent sound design. The film is guided by director Ožvold herself, whose commentary adds another dimension to the film. I very much appreciate the interplay of facts, philosophy and photogeny. It is challenging not to dwell on the image at the expense of listening to the individual performers' testimonies. However, the ways in which the 'talking heads' have been incorporated into the film - in the form of playback on televisions or through projectors - is, in my opinion, genius. Without a doubt, the film deserves to be seen and sent across to audiences around the world. "And now. Subtitles."
